Transaction 3e2e9854f8071f91981defa87b9176e185b4d18d9611da9424c949b6c42feda7
1 Input
2 Outputs
- 3e2e9854f8071f91981defa87b9176e185b4d18d9611da9424c949b6c42feda7:0
- 3e2e9854f8071f91981defa87b9176e185b4d18d9611da9424c949b6c42feda7:1
value 25559
address 12PGJeabCoNN4xipnDSwsdCRWyd1NbPLuc
value 524307
address 1P9z3hWUg5aWj7LMoo31vtXdM4vcBDkqjQ